The development is going up in part thanks to a new interchangefor the highway at Discovery Parkway, that will be next to about$1.3 billion in new campus projects going up for the University ofMissouri, including a new life sciences incubator and healthsciences building. The new mixed-use development would also bebuilt across Highway 63 from the 114-acre Discovery Ridge researchpark. A new 500-acre park, that will include a lake, as well as newsoccer and baseball fields, is being developed by the city next toDiscovery as well. "Columbia is a very vibrant town," Lindner says."We're in a perfect spot."

There's demand for all of the uses, Lindner says. "There's a lotof big box retailers who want to get into the city, but there's noplace for them to go. We've got a few letters of intent for theretail." He says the company also has an office user that's takinga planned three-story building totaling about 100,000 sf. The namecan't be disclosed yet, he says. "We should be making anannouncement about that in the next 30 to 60 days," Lindner tellsGlobeSt.com. "We'll have the ability to accommodate up to 500,000sf in shovel-ready office sites. We'll probably end up with sevendifferent office sites." He says the company is not ready to breakdown amount of retail stores, or the split between the proposedcondos and apartments.

The interchange work is expected to be complete this year, andthe firm will start construction on the Discovery project inmid-2009, he says. "It's a five-year project. By the time retailcomes back and we get a few office users, I think you're looking ata 2014 to 2015 time frame," Lindner says.
